Hello jay2333. I take it you are a medical student. Rather than attempting to describe the many possible meanings of "of" (a huge task), I'll try to recast your three phrases without the use of "of".

pneumonia that develops during the course of another disease = pneumonia secondary to another disease

second most [frequent or common] cause of community pneumonia = the agent that gives rise to most community pneumonia after [the single more frequent cause]

is composed of hundreds of = is made from hundreds of

I think definition number 7 is the best definition. But for all of the examples below, what comes after "of" modifies or expands on what becomes before "of". In most of your examples, a noun comes before "of" and what comes after "of" gives more information about the noun before "of".

building of great height what kind of building? a building of great height
hole of great depth what kind of hole? a hole of great depth
and so on with the sentences below

cyanosis of increasing severity - cyanosis whose severity increases
bank balance of decreasing magnitude - bank balance that gets smaller

I'm unsure about the bottom sentences.mostly the same as above

pneumonia that develops during the course of another disease.develops during what course? the course of another disease
second most common cause of community pneumonia. what cause? the cause of community pneumonia

is composed of hundreds of closely related people (for example) This one is different from the other examples in that "composed" is not a noun. But "hundreds of............people" still gives us information about the past participle "composed".
